This Pronoun Matching & Sorting Board Set is a hands-on, visual grammar resource that helps young learners identify and use the pronouns he, she, and they. Perfect for literacy centers, small group instruction, and special education settings.
What’s Included:
- Pronoun Boards 1 & 2 – Sentence Completion
- Look at the picture and complete the sentence
- Example: (Picture) ___ is building a sand castle
- 14 sentences to complete
- Includes word-only and word + picture pronoun cards
- Boards: 8.5" x 11" | Cards: 1.5" x 1"
- Pronoun Board 3 – Sorting Board
- Sort 30 picture cards under the correct pronoun: He, She, or They
- Board: 8.5" x 11" | Cards: 1" x 1.5"
- Pronoun Boards 4 & 5 – Matching Boards
- Match the correct pronoun to each picture
- Includes both word-only and word + picture cards
- 25 pronoun-picture matches
- Boards: 8.5" x 11" | Cards: 1.75" x 1.5"
This resource helps build sentence structure, pronoun recognition, and visual discrimination. Ideal for Pre-K, Kindergarten, 1st Grade, ESL learners, and students with IEP goals related to grammar.
